GLP-1
GLP-1 receptor agonists (semaglutide or tirzepatide) are the metabolic engine of this stack. By mimicking glucagon-like peptide-1, they suppress appetite at the hypothalamic level, slow gastric emptying, and improve insulin sensitivity — creating a caloric deficit that drives systemic fat loss.
In the context of this comprehensive stack, GLP-1 handles fat loss while Enclomiphene, Tesamorelin, and Tadalafil preserve muscle, restore hormones, target deep visceral fat, and optimize circulation.
Enclomiphene
Enclomiphene is a selective estrogen receptor modulator (SERM) that works upstream on your hypothalamic-pituitary-gonadal (HPG) axis. It stimulates your own production of LH and FSH, naturally restoring testosterone levels without suppressing your endogenous production.
In a transformation context, this matters because testosterone is essential for muscle growth, drive, and favorable body composition. By restoring it naturally, you maintain the hormonal environment that makes the rest of the stack work — and ensures your testosterone recovers post-protocol.
Tesamorelin
Tesamorelin is a growth hormone-releasing hormone (GHRH) analog that stimulates GH production specifically for the purpose of fat loss. Uniquely, clinical studies show it preferentially targets visceral adipose tissue — the metabolically active, inflammation-promoting fat that most diet and exercise approaches cannot address.
In this transformation stack, Tesamorelin complements GLP-1's systemic fat loss with clinical precision on visceral fat. The combination creates comprehensive fat loss without the muscle-wasting that GLP-1 alone can cause.
Tadalafil Daily
Tadalafil is a phosphodiesterase-5 inhibitor that supports vascular function and blood flow through smooth muscle relaxation. Daily dosing maintains consistent support for endothelial function and circulation, amplifying the delivery of what the other three compounds are producing.

Common Questions
Why do I need labs for this stack?
Enclomiphene affects your hormonal pathways directly — it works on your hypothalamic-pituitary-gonadal axis to stimulate your own testosterone production. For safety and efficacy, your physician needs baseline lab work to assess your current hormonal state, ensure Enclomiphene is appropriate for you, and monitor your testosterone levels throughout the protocol. This is standard medical practice for any hormone-affecting treatment.

What labs do I need, and how does Obsidian provide them?
Your physician will determine which labs are needed based on your health history — typically testosterone levels, estradiol, liver function, and general health markers. Obsidian Genetics will provide lab requisitions and direct you to a lab near you. All labs are arranged through your consultation, and costs are communicated upfront. You’ll have baseline labs before starting, and follow-up labs as your physician recommends.
How do I manage the injections?
Tesamorelin is a daily subcutaneous injection and takes under a minute. GLP-1 is once weekly. Enclomiphene and Tadalafil are oral, taken daily.
